I have a dell 1420 with a 250GB Hardrive that's failing. I bought a momentus 500GB from newegg but found that it has a female SATA port. My current Hardrive has a male SATA connection (pins sticking out the slides into the port in the laptop.) I tried looking for male SATA Hardrive online but couldn't find any. Is there a specific name for it? I would think that if it mentions that it is compatible with a dell Inspiron 1420, it build have the corresponding ports.
Can anyone suggest what I should do?

Check to make sure that what is on your current HDD is not an adaptor that can be removed and used with the new HDD.
I'm pretty sure that you can't buy a 'custom' SATA port Momentus HDD... - could you link to the part you actually bought?
I'm pretty sure that your original HDD has a port adaptor on it to make it attach easier/better to your notebook.
